Title:
Antenna design by genetic algorithms

Abstract:
ARCON Corporation, in collaboration with The Pennsylvania State University Applied Research Laboratory, proposes to develop a genetic algorithm (GA) that places multiple antennas and/or arrays on a platform in order to optimize the radiation pattern objectives and spectrum co-utilization. We will investigate the application of different types of genetic algorithms to optimize several hybrid electromagnetic models. The proposed research includes: (1) exploring several possible chromosome representations in the GA, including binary, real, and mixed; (2) trying several types of GA, such as Pareto, Efficient Global Optimization (EGO), and mixed integer; (3) testing methods of increasing the computational speed of the cost function in order to accelerate the GA; and (4) finding appropriate constraints on the parameters in order to narrow the search space
